Definitions for din
Overview of noun din
The noun din has 2 senses? (first 2 from tagged texts)
1. (9) blare, blaring, cacophony, clamor, din
(a loud harsh or strident noise)
2. (7) commotion, din, ruction, ruckus, rumpus, tumult
(the act of making a noisy disturbance)
Overview of verb din
The verb din has 2 senses? (first 2 from tagged texts)
1. (1) boom, din
(make a resonant sound, like artillery; "His deep voice boomed through the hall")
2. (1) din
(instill (into a person) by constant repetition; "he dinned the lessons into his students")
